diff --git a/src/public/app/services/content_renderer.js b/src/public/app/services/content_renderer.js index 359366282..a19c47e5b 100644 --- a/src/public/app/services/content_renderer.js +++ b/src/public/app/services/content_renderer.js @@ -122,10 +122,10 @@ async function renderText(note, $renderedContent) { async function renderCode(note, $renderedContent) { const blob = await note.getBlob(); - const $codeBlock = $("
");
+ const $codeBlock = $("");
$codeBlock.text(blob.content);
- applySingleBlockSyntaxHighlight($codeBlock, mime_types.normalizeMimeTypeForCKEditor(note.mime));
- $renderedContent.append($codeBlock);
+ $renderedContent.append($("").append($codeBlock));
+ await applySingleBlockSyntaxHighlight($codeBlock, mime_types.normalizeMimeTypeForCKEditor(note.mime));
}
function renderImage(entity, $renderedContent, options = {}) {